  • Brevard: Nestled just 3 miles from Pisgah Forest, Brevard is a charming city renowned for its stunning outdoor landscapes and vibrant arts scene. Visitors flock here year-round, with peak traffic in June to July and September. Brevard's allure lies in its rich recreational opportunities, including hiking, biking, and golfing. Nature enthusiasts will appreciate the nearby national and state parks, as well as picturesque lakes that offer serene views. The city's quaint downtown features local shops and restaurants, making it a perfect spot to relax after a day of adventure.

Best time to go to Pisgah Forest

The best time to visit Pisgah Forest can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Pisgah Forest falls in July,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Pisgah Forest falls in January,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January36.9°F (2.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low
February41.2°F (5.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March47.5°F (8.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
May63.5°F (17.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June70.7°F (21.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
July73.6°F (23.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August72.0°F (22.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
September66.9°F (19.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
November46.9°F (8.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
December41.5°F (5.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age

When is the best time to go to Pisgah Forest?
The most popular time to visit Pisgah Forest is during the fall, particularly in October. At this time, the foliage transforms into a breathtaking tapestry of reds, oranges, and yellows, making it a prime season for leaf-peeping and outdoor photography. With average temperatures ranging from the mid-50s to low 70s Fahrenheit, the weather is pleasantly cool, superb for hiking along the numerous trails or enjoying a scenic drive through the forest.

During the peak season, which spans from late spring through early fall, you'll find an abundance of activities that cater to the adventurous spirit. The warmer months invite visitors to partake in activities like mountain biking, fishing, and white-water rafting, while the mild autumn climate provides an ideal backdrop for leisurely strolls and picnics amid nature's vibrant display.

For those who appreciate a quieter experience, visiting in late September or early October not only allows you to enjoy the stunning fall colors but can also offer a more tranquil atmosphere as families return home for the school year. This time can be particularly rewarding as you can immerse yourself in the serene beauty of the forest without the summer crowds.
